Grab your binoculars and hit the trails as fall migration hits its peak! Celebrate World Migratory Bird Day by spotting a colorful cast of migratory visitors - like American Redstarts, Tennessee Warblers, and soaring raptors - alongside local favorites such as Yellow-bellied Sapsuckers, Eastern Bluebirds, and Cedar Waxwings. As we walk, we'll tune in to flight calls, watch the fields and trees come alive with movement, and connect with the wonder of birds on the wing.
